(iii) Liability for claims arising out of any product which
    with the insured's knowledge is intended for
    incorporation into the structure, machinery or control
    of any aircraft. For e.g, the insured may be supplying
    products like aircraft engine or tyres for aircraft.

A defective part may result in damage to the aircraft
or even a crash. Such catastrophic risk is covered
by specialist aviation insurance market. The
products liability policy does not cover liability for
such claims.

(iv) Liability arising out of any product guarantee.
    Manufacturers often guarantee their product for a
    specified period and replace or repair defective parts
    during the guarantee period.

The costs of repair, replacement etc are actually
business risks and cannot be covered under an
insurance policy, as they would require underwriting
a manufacturer's technical skills and know-how.
